Nice trail system. Well marked, well maintained. Some cool features and some very technical climbing and descending. Only complaint is there is not much flow and speed here. Mostly switch backs and tight cornering (great for working on your skill).

★★★★☆ — Jason , Sep 2018

Simply sensational! Dryer Road Park is a perfect example of what can be done with a little ingenuity and access. The park features a lacrosse field, soccer fields, a playground, pavillion and public restroom. But it's the Mountain Bike trails that are at the heart of this area.

★★★★★ — Mike , Aug 2019

I'm kind of new to the mountain bike world. I've done 5 or 6 different park lately. This one was by far the most fun an diverse that I have tried. All the trail are around a field at the top of a hill. This way it's easy to find his way back to the park.

★★★★★ — Todo , Jun 2020

Great mountain biking. Trails for all levels of riders. Beginner trails, tech trails, flow trails, one jump line. The jump track is in good shape. The pump track is in need of repair.

★★★★☆ — Brent , May 2025
